How Do You Get Ready for a Margaret River Wine Tour?

Margaret River is one of the most well-known wine regions in the world. Margaret River, located in Western Australia, is home to some of the country’s best wineries and produces some of the world’s finest wines. If you’re heading to Margaret River, here are a few things you should know to get the most out of your wine tour. When planning Margaret River wine tours, it is critical to work with a reputable and experienced tour operator. There are numerous wine tours available in the Margaret River region, but not all of them are created equal.

When it comes to wine tours, experience matters a lot, and you want to make sure that your tour operator knows the ins and outs of the region. Also, inquire about the mode of transportation used on the tour. Some businesses use buses or vans, whereas others may provide a more intimate experience with a smaller vehicle. There are various types of Margaret River wine tours, so you should decide which one you want before making a reservation. Group tours, private tours, and even self-guided tours are available. Each type of tour has advantages and disadvantages, so you must select the one that best meets your requirements.

Group tours are usually the most affordable option and a great way to meet other people who share your interests. However, you will be in a large group and may not be able to see everything you want. Private tours are more expensive.
When planning a Margaret River wine tour, keep your budget in mind. There are numerous ways to save money on your tour, but it is critical to be aware of the potential costs in order to make the most informed decision.

Booking ahead of time is one way to save money on your tour. Many operators provide discounts for early bookings, so it pays to plan ahead of time. You should also consider the season in which you travel. The peak season for tourism in Margaret River is between November and April, so visiting during this time will be more expensive.
